The public middle schools with the highest share of multiracial students in Prince George's County, Maryland

This ranking covers the public middle schools with the highest share of multiracial students in Prince George's County, Maryland, drawn from 25 qualifying public middle schools. Gwynn Park Middle leads the list at 3.0%, against a median of 0.8% across the ranked schools.
